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Newmarket to Newbury Racecourse start from £69.70 one way, or £69.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newmarket to Newbury Racecourse are available for £70.20 one way, or £113.10 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at Newmarket Station

While Newmarket station does not house a ticket office, passengers can utilize the available ticket machines to collect pre-booked tickets. For those who prefer digital solutions, smartcard validators are installed for convenience. There is step-free access to the platforms, catering well to travelers with limited mobility. Assistance can be provided if booked in advance, ensuring everyone can travel with ease.

However, the station lacks certain amenities, such as wa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, and toilets. Travelers might want to plan ahead for these essentials before arriving at the station. Cycling enthusiasts will find ample bike storage space, with 78 stands available near the platform.

Transport Links and Connections

Newmarket train station is well-connected, offering numerous options for onward travel. Local bus services can be accessed just outside the station on Green Road, where rail replacement bus services are also available if necessary. While there are no direct taxi ranks or car hire facilities, travelers can arrange for these services to ensure their journey continues smoothly.

Facilities and Amenities at Newbury Racecourse Station

The station at Newbury Racecourse doesn't feature a traditional ticket office, but it does provide ticket machines for easy collection of p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is at the heart of the station's design, with accessible ticket machines and induction loops available for the hearing impaired.

While there are no waiting rooms or lounges here, passengers can take advantage of the seating area provided. The station is equipped with CCTV, ensuring a secure environment for all travelers. Keep in mind, however, that there are no on-site refreshment facilities, shops, or ATM machines, so plan accordingly.

Accessibility and Assistance

Newbury Racecourse station ensures that travel is comfortable for everyone by offering step-free access to Platform 3. However, other platforms require the use of a footbridge or a few steps, which may pose difficulties for some. Assistance is available through the Customer Help Points, and advance assistance bookings can be made via Passenger Assist. More details can be found through the National Rail Passenger Assist website.

Onward Travel Options

Travelers arriving at or departing from Newbury Racecourse station have several transportation choices. Rail replacement services are accessible from nearby bus stops on Hanbridge Road.
